Sat 692869024123067

decimal
138573.4024123067
degree
0°138573′1485″4024123067‴
percentile
32.993763089772536%
name
iydfsluacpq
cycle
0
epoch
0
period
68
block
138573
offset
4024123067
timestamp
rarity
common